Inspiration

Music platforms such as Spotify and Apple Music take a large percentage of royalties from their own artists. Which we believe should not be the case. Musicians are expected to enjoy the majority of their work. Aside from that, these platforms have the censor your content anytime they want. Music, podcasts, and similar content should be owned and controlled by the user. It should not be taken over by a third party.

What it does

Pandos is a decentralized music, podcast and online radio platform built on IPFS that offers the ability to upload, stream and play music. The goal is to create a free decentralized version music platform which artists get paid directly through listener support.

Our application does four(4) things really well

Create: It allows podcast creators to record their podcasts directly from our website. And then upload them for their users to listen.

Meta Space provides an intuitive user experience when it comes to creating a space for a conversation about anything. Send live reactions, tip users,and many other things.

NFT:Artists can mint their album covers as NFTS and reap the benefits of both their fans purchasing the music and their NFTS.

Chat: Send live messages during online space session on pandos.

How we built it

Solidity: as Main Coding Language for writing smart contract

ReactJs: as Main Coding Language for Creating The UI components (Front End)

TailwindCss: as Main Coding Language for styling UI components

IPFS: For Storing of files

Web3 Storage: For Storing of files

Moralis: as Tool for creating the chat section

Github : For Repo Storage and source code management

Git : For Version Control System

Quick Node : Blockchain related APIs

Challenges we ran into

Lack of Testing Since I only joined the hackathon in November, I had to devote all of my time to other tasks rather than writing tests, such as brainstorming, design, developing UX/UI + backend, and demo. A lot of the difficulties that came up may have been avoided if I had had a few more weeks to create dependable tests. But again, this is a hackathon submission so it's understandable.

What's next for Pandos

Use pandora coin to buy or rent free available premium features such as upgraded streaming quality or content exclusive channels

Users can follow artists and receive notifications when new songs or podcasts are released.

A live video streaming feature that allows artists to interact with their fans or followers in real time.

Built With

Share this project:

Updates